It depends based on the particular school, but generally:
4.0 = A's
3.5 = 50/50 A's and B's
3.0 = B's
2.5 = 50/50 B's and C's
2.0 = C's
1.5 = 50/50 C's and D's
1.0 = D's
0.5 = 50/50 D's and F's
0.0 = F's
Some schools have a scale up to 5.0, but that's less common.
